Abstract
Grading of olive fruits is important for export and local marketing. Grading
parameters were length, width, thickness, and weight of olive. The mechanical
grading, reduce the period needed to sort the olive varieties compared to manual
grading, and the olives price depend on its size.
The Belts grading machine for olive fruits was manufactured, and installed at
the Agricultural, Engineering Department, Faculty of Agriculture, EI-Mansoura
University. However, the experiment was carried out at Kafr-Awd, Aga. Dakahlia
Governorate. The machine was tested in grading of Agize, Manzanillo and Picual olive
varieties. Grading was based on olive parameters such as (dimensions of fruits and
mass) and machine parameters conditions (belts speed m Is, grading unit slop age.
Rad. and olives feeding rate g/s).
Result indicated that the maximum grading efficiency of olive varieties
Manzanillo, Agiza and Picual, it was 93 %, 92 % and 91, %, respectively. These
results were obtained at the same operation conditions of feed rate 50 g/s. belts
speed 0.110 mls and tilt angle of -0.035 Rad. ).
